What you'll do

  • Your role will be to provide project visibility and help make timely decisions.

    You will work closely with the Project Manager and coordinate with all disciplines:

    • You will develop and maintain the project schedule (baseline schedule).

    • You will define sequences, milestones, and analyze the critical path.

    • You will track actual on-site progress and update the schedule.

    • You will identify deviations and analyze schedule risks.

    • You will propose optimization alternatives (re-planning, overlaps, fast-track...).

    • You will coordinate with contractors, the design team, and the client.

    • You will prepare progress reports and reporting for decision-making.

    • You will assess the impact of technical or scope changes on the schedule.

It is a highly analytical role, but with direct impact on the project.

What do you need to fit in?

  • We are looking for profiles with a project mindset, analytical skills, and a global vision:

    • Engineering, Architecture, or similar.

    • 3 to 5 years of experience in construction or infrastructure project planning.

    • Experience in on-site environments and coordination with contractors.

    • Knowledge of planning (WBS, critical path, milestones).

    • Advanced English level.

    • Analytical, organized profile with a deadline-driven mindset.

    💡 Highly valued:

    • Experience in Data Centers or critical infrastructure.

    • Proficiency in Primavera P6, MS Project, or Power BI.

    • Knowledge of advanced planning analysis (risks/claims).
